// Resolver retry ceiling for the Hollybrook ingest service.
// Our upstream DNS at the Tarnmoor edge intermittently returns
// SERVFAIL during cache rollover, which made pods flap every few
// hours. Three retries with jittered backoff rides out the blip
// without masking real outages. If you're on call and see repeated
// lookup failures past this ceiling, escalate rather than raising
// the constant. The first build carrying this value is noted below.

pipeline stamp: htk9_ce63042d9

The ProctorPath queue holds exam sessions flagged for human review — webcam dropouts, identity mismatches, and timing anomalies. Support handles tier-one triage: confirm the flag reason, check the candidate's session log, and either release the exam or escalate to the integrity team. Average handling target is under four hours. You'll work these tickets through the Queueside console, which talks to the internal ProctorPath API on your behalf. To set up your console profile on day one, enter the team key shown below.

gateway credential: qvz7-vWy80ME

## Handover: Garrowton Garage Feed

Short version: the occupancy feed from the Garrowton municipal garages arrives over MQTT, one message per gate event. The aggregator dedupes by gate ID and publishes counts every thirty seconds. Watch the Larkspur Deck sensor — it double-fires on cold mornings, and the dedupe window masks it most of the time. Alerts go to the parking channel. Don't touch the dedupe window without checking downstream dashboards. Current config is as follows.

settings of fafog-haduf:
ZORIX_PIN=4648
ZORIX_METRICS_HOST=metrics.zorix.paliqsys.corp
ZORIX_LOG_LEVEL=info
ZORIX_TENANT=druix

Internal memo — to the warehouse shift lead

Re: outbound film reels, Ostergale Archive consignment

The eight reels from the Millbrook collection are crated, sealed, and logged in the cool store. They must remain there until the Bellhaven courier arrives Thursday morning; do not stage them early, as the dock exceeds safe temperature by mid-morning. Verify the seals are unbroken before release and record the time. At the hand-over itself, apply the confidential instruction provided directly below.

dispatch memo: the eliath belael courier leaves the praox ledger at gate 8841 under passcode 017589